My first flight

salam,

Last saturday, my friends and i have gone to subang airport to examine one of experimental aircraft that in Malaysia that is CH701 that also designed and produced by zenith aircraft company. Some of the avionics team decided to have a look on its avionics and electrical wiring for this airplane so that they can get some knowledge on how the wiring works or how it is connected generally. Although this is a different airplane that we are building now, that is CH750, but, generally, it is almost the same especially on the airframe.

So, i decided to follow them to have a better look on how some parts are connected and how assembly works.After few hours of work, examining the airplane, Capt Siva arrived and he offered us to have a fly with the CH701. Wow, a great opportunity for us to fly here in Subang and as for me, and the same to the rest of us, this is our first flight with light airplane. But due to lack of time, only me is selected to fly with the ch701 so that i can more appreciate on the airplane that i currently assemble in my workplace.


 So, before the flight, this is the time to take some pictures few minutes before take off. A bit scared because this is a light airplane but because of the confidence of the airplane and the pilot himself, i have left my scary feelings in the hangar.

So here i am, in the CH701 airplane, waiting at the side of the runaway to give way for 3 passes airplanes before we take off the ground. At this moment, Engine are tested with high RPM so that the engine is in good condition, meters and avionics are also checked for their normal behavior. After all are checked, ATC gives us clearance to take off.


So, we take off and climb to 1500 ft above ground level. Its me as in the right position and on my left is capt siva who piloted this ch701. very experienced pilot and his skills on controlling the control stick is very high and precise. He taught me to hold the control stick gently, and not to hard so that the airplane will react slowly. he also taught me on what are servo trims is about and how the G's feels. I only felt for 1.5 G after he maneuver the airplane and, wow, this is how its feel as before this, i only watch the G's effect in youtube. It cannot be described here.

And this is the view from the left side of the airplane. There are some area of construction site and capt siva said, that is enough for landing because of its firm soil. So, after ATC gave clearance, we descend to 500 ft and try to simulate an emergency landing on the construction site. So, we fly for an altitude 500 ft above the site and he showed me that this aircraft possibly can land on the site. After that, we climb again to 1500 ft and towards port Klang.


 So here are some pictures along the flight that is great to view.

 Here is the cockpit of the airplane. With the airplane nose downward, we are descending for landing procedure to the subang airport.

The CH701 gently flies parallel to the runway to make sure no aircraft or object on the runway. At this time, I can see a white airplane is flying toward the runway and lands. So, as the ATC report to us, we are the second plane. We landed safely after 0.5 hours flight with the CH701.

CH750 SHORT TAKE OFF LANDING (STOL) PROJECT

 Salam,

For 2011, i am on my way completing my School vision project that is building a CH750 kit project. This airplane project is a great project. At the end of the project, our university will have a two seater experimental airplane that can be fly to the civil airspace around Malaysia and also not to forget, around the globe.

We received this kit on early 2011 and these pictures are some of the pictures that i can share with you guys about building a small part of the airplane that is the slats. Do you know what is slat? slat is a lifting device that is located in front, along the wing. These slats will helps the airflow to be more attached to the wing so that the wing will have more efficient lift rather than conventional design. Why does this airplane call experimental? It is because of this slat that are usually applied to big airplane such as an airbus or Boeing airplane that can take about 300 to 400 passengers. while this slat is install on this small aircraft that is only for two passengers.

As for those who are not in airline or aerospace industry, maybe it is difficult to imagine what is airfoil, wings and also this special parts that is slat. As you can see, in these pictures, these slats are made of aluminium and not just this slats, other parts also are built by aluminum. It is because it is light in weight.

The corner ribs are clecoed and drilled with 30 size along the slat

The top rib and top skin are examined to fit with the pilot hole and are drilled with 30 size

The top rib are drilled using 30 size. then, the top skin is clecoed along the pilot hole line that are located at the aft slat and drilled space (selang)

 cleco the hole that have been drilled with 30 size

Bottom skin is clecoed and drill along the aft slat pilot 

Grip pin is ready to be removed
Finished drilled slat with A4
